Che Palle!

Italy Travel August 23, 2017 0 Comments

The queue is made famous by Britain. Brits, specifically, urbanites love nothing more than to stand single file in an orderly line. It’s innately ingrained within the culture. Queuing is acceptable, a shamble mess of frustrated eruptions and tut-tuts is not.

